What Is the SPDR S&P 600 Small Cap Value ETF (SLYV)? Investors looking for smaller American companies with value potential often come across the SPDR S&P 600 Small Cap Value ETF, commonly known by its ticker symbol SLYV. This ETF focuses on small-cap value stocks in the United States and aims to track the performance of the S&P SmallCap 600 Value Index. Instead of investing in giant corporations, SLYV gives exposure to smaller businesses that may be trading at relatively lower prices compared to their earnings, sales, or book values. Because of this approach, many long-term investors use SLYV as a way to diversify their portfolios and potentially benefit from the growth of undervalued small companies. The 3D Printing ETF (PRNT) is a U.S.-listed exchange-traded fund designed to provide exposure to companies involved in the global 3D printing industry. Rather than focusing on a single technology or country, PRNT tracks an index that includes exchange-listed companies from the United States, developed international markets, and Taiwan. These companies are selected based on their involvement in various aspects of the 3D printing value chain. PRNT is often viewed as a thematic ETF, targeting long-term technological change rather than short-term market trends. 2.
